Junction box with multiple wiring modes and good IP performance
Technical Field
The utility model relates to a junction box technical field especially relates to a good junction box that has multiple mode of connection of IP performance.
Background
The junction box is a switching circuit, marks branch circuit, for wiring and survey line provide convenient interface arrangement, under some circumstances, for construction and debugging, the mountable sets up comparatively regular product, generally adopts the different wires of terminal block tandem connection when the junction box uses. The excessive connecting wire of circuit, the circuit wire jumper, the box of cross-over usefulness is usually regarded as to present junction box to according to the voltage of difference, set for different terminal boards, when overhauing, open the door usually and overhaul the box inside, simultaneously, wear out the bottom plate of cable below the box.
But the junction box on the market has a lot of not enough, and ordinary junction box, binding post are single, and when the cable connection to different specifications, it is inconvenient to appear the wiring, wastes time and energy moreover, and in the inlet wire and the position of being qualified for the next round of competitions, because sealed not well causes the infiltration phenomenon, even done sealed processing, cause the damage to the cable surface easily, produce electric leakage phenomenon moreover.

Referring to fig. 1 to 4, a connection box with multiple wiring modes and good IP performance includes a box body 1, a plurality of first flanges 2 welded to the outer wall of the bottom of the box body 1, the first flanges 2 being capable of fixing cables, and the tops of the first flanges 2 penetrating into the box body 1, a sealing ring 4 disposed on the top of the first flanges 2, the sealing ring 4 being disposed inside the first flanges 2 for protecting and sealing the cables, a top cover 5 disposed on the outer wall of the top of the box body 1, a hinge 6 connected to the outer wall of one side of the box body 1 through a bolt, a box door 7 connected to the hinge 6 through a bolt, a clamp block 3 disposed on the outer wall of one side of the box door 7, and a sealing pad 8 bonded to one side wall of the clamp block 3, the clamp block 3 being embedded in the box body 1, and contacting with the box body 1 through the sealing pad 8 on the edge of the embedding block 3, so, two trapezoid strips 10 are arranged in parallel on the inner wall of one side of the box body 1, one trapezoid strip 10 is connected with a first trapezoid block 11 in a sliding mode, two side walls of the first trapezoid block 11 are fixedly connected with second flanges 13, the outer wall of one side of the first trapezoid block 11 is fixedly connected with a wiring block 15, the other trapezoid strip 10 is connected with a second trapezoid block 17 in a sliding mode, through holes 19 are formed in the outer walls of two sides of the second trapezoid block 17, a first wiring clamp 20 in a circular truncated cone shape is inserted into each through hole 19, the first wiring clamp 20 is made of copper, a first blade 18 is arranged inside each first wiring clamp 20, the first blade 18 is made of copper, when a cable is inserted, an insulating layer of the cable is cut off, the first blade 18 serves as a conductor, the outer wall of the front face of the second trapezoid block 17 is fixedly connected with a second wiring clamp 21 in an E shape, the second wiring clamp 21 is made of copper, a second blade 22 is obliquely arranged on the inner wall of the second, by snapping the conductor into the second clamp 21 and severing the cable insulation by the second blade 22.
Furthermore, the outer wall of one side of the box body 1 is provided with a lock hole 23, the edge of one side of the box door 7 is provided with a lock tongue 9, the specification of the lock tongue 9 is matched with the specification of the lock hole 23 to form, the box door 1 is closed, and the lock tongue 9 can be inserted into the lock hole 23 to fix the box door.
Furthermore, the second flange 13 and the junction block 15 are connected in a copper sheet welding mode, and a screw 16 is arranged on the outer wall of one side of the junction block 15, so that a lead can be inserted into the junction block 15 and fastened through the screw 16.
Further, a copper ring 14 is sleeved at the bottom of the first jointing clamp 20, the copper ring 14 is connected with the second jointing clamp 21 through a copper sheet, and the copper ring 14 can form a sliding connection with the first jointing clamp 20.
Further, trapezoidal groove 12 has all been opened to first trapezoidal piece 11 and second trapezoidal piece 17 bottom outer wall, and trapezoidal groove 12 and trapezoidal strip 10 sliding connection, and trapezoidal groove 12 cup joints and forms sliding connection on trapezoidal strip 10, has made things convenient for the inconvenience that causes because of the position when working a telephone switchboard.
The working principle is as follows: when in use, firstly, the bolt 9 is rotated by a key, the box door 7 is opened, then the cable passes through the first flange 2 and the sealing ring 4 positioned at the top end of the first flange 2 from the bottom, the first flange 2 is screwed, then the first trapezoidal block 11 and the second trapezoidal block 17 are respectively clamped on the trapezoidal strip 10, the first trapezoidal block 11 and the second trapezoidal block 17 are slid to proper positions, the wiring mode of a lead is selected, the cable stripped of an insulating layer is connected to the first trapezoidal block 11 and is fixed by screwing the second flange 13, or the cable is inserted into the wiring block 15 and is fixed by the screw 16 on the outer wall of the wiring block 15, the wiring mode with an insulating skin is selected, the cable can be connected to the second trapezoidal block 17, the first wiring clamp 17 is inserted into the first wiring clamp 20, the first wiring clamp 17 is inserted into the through hole 19 by little pressure to form fixed connection, the insulating layer of the cable is cut by the first blade 18 in the first wiring clamp 17, the first blade 18 is used as a conductor to connect the wire, and the cable may be clamped into the interior of the second clamp 21, and the second blade 22 cuts the cable insulation, allowing the larger piece to serve as a conductor to connect the wire.
